"Blood and Boundaries: Religious and Racial Exclusions and their Limits in Colonial Latin America examines how Spain and Portugal's late Medieval policies of exclusion and discrimination based on religious origins and genealogy were transfered to Latin America where they were transformed and amplified into a system of social ranking based on race or color, but one modified by considerations of nobility, honor, profession, and service.
